1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the equation of a line with a slope of -1 and a y-intercept of 2?

Back

y = -x + 2

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Write the equation in point-slope form of the line that passes through the point (4, -7) with a slope of -1/4.

Back

y + 7 = -1/4(x - 4)

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are Alternate Interior Angles?

Back

Angles that are on opposite sides of the transversal and inside the two lines.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the slope of the line represented by the equation y - 3 = 2(x + 4)?

Back

2

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are Consecutive Interior Angles?

Back

Angles that are on the same side of the transversal and inside the two lines.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you convert the equation y = mx + b to point-slope form?

Back

Use the formula y - y1 = m(x - x1) where (x1, y1) is a point on the line.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the slope-intercept form of a line?

Back

y = mx + b, where m is the slope and b is the y-intercept.
